探索AWS云服务:让你的网页更具活力
在当今的数字化时代,网页的动态效果已成为吸引用户眼球的重要手段之一。尤其是图片自动轮播效果,它能够在不打扰用户的情况下展现多个信息,为网站增添动感。结合亚马逊云(AWS)强大的计算和存储能力,开发者可以轻松实现这种效果,让网站的互动性和用户体验达到新的高度。
一、AWS云服务的优势
亚马逊云计算(AWS)是全球领先的云计算服务平台,它提供了强大且灵活的基础设施,支持各类业务需求。从网站托管、数据存储到计算资源,AWS都能够满足各种规模企业的需求。对于开发者来说,AWS的服务不仅具备高可用性和安全性,还具有弹性扩展能力,帮助企业随着业务需求的变化灵活调整资源。
AWS的一大优势在于其全球范围内的数据中心覆盖,这使得开发者可以将网站托管在离用户更近的地理位置,从而提供更快的访问速度和更低的延迟。此外,AWS还拥有强大的安全措施,包括加密、身份验证、访问控制等,确保用户数据的安全性。
二、AWS支持的技术栈
无论是前端还是后端开发,AWS都提供了丰富的技术支持。对于网页设计者而言,使用AWS服务可以方便地存储图片、视频等资源,并通过CDN(内容分发网络)加速这些资源的加载速度,提升用户体验。
具体来说,AWS的S3(Simple Storage Service)可以为开发者提供高效、安全的存储服务,帮助开发者管理和存取网页上的静态资源。而CloudFront则作为AWS的全球内容分发网络,能够确保图片和其他资源快速加载,减少因服务器负载过高带来的性能瓶颈。

三、HTML图片自动轮播的实现
实现图片自动轮播的功能,可以让网站在展示多张图片时更具动态效果,从而吸引更多的用户。使用HTML和CSS结合JavaScript可以轻松实现这一效果。而当这些图片存储在AWS云中时,借助AWS的技术优势,轮播效果不仅流畅,而且更加稳定。
以下是实现图片自动轮播的基本HTML代码:
.slider { width: 100%; height: 300px; overflow: hidden; position: relative; } .slider img { width: 100%; height: 100%; position: absolute; animation: slide 15s infinite; } @keyframes slide { 0% { opacity: 1; } 33% { opacity: 0; } 66% { opacity: 0; } 100% { opacity: 1; } }
上面的代码简单实现了图片轮播的效果。在实际应用中,可以根据需要调整图片的数量、大小、轮播速度等设置。将图片上传到AWS的S3存储桶后,只需替换图片的URL,即可实现云端资源的动态展示。
四、AWS的CDN加速让轮播更流畅
图片轮播的流畅度对用户体验至关重要。AWS CloudFront作为AWS的全球CDN加速服务,可以确保存储在AWS S3上的图片以最快的速度加载到用户设备上。通过CloudFront,用户访问网站时,图片会从最近的边缘节点加载,减少延迟,提高页面加载速度。
在设置CloudFront时,只需将S3存储桶作为源,CloudFront会自动优化资源分发,保证图片轮播效果的流畅性。无论用户身处何地,都能享受优质的访问体验。
五、可扩展性和弹性:随时应对流量激增
网站访问量的波动是不可避免的,尤其是在活动促销或高峰时段,流量往往会急剧增加。AWS的弹性伸缩功能可以帮助你在流量激增时自动扩展资源,确保网站的稳定性和高可用性。通过使用Auto Scaling和Elastic Load Balancing,AWS能够根据实际流量需求自动调节服务器容量,确保图片轮播和其他功能的流畅运行。
六、安全保障:保护用户数据与隐私
网站的安全性一直是开发者关注的重点。AWS为用户提供了强大的安全措施,确保网站和用户数据的安全。无论是在存储、传输还是访问层面,AWS都提供了全面的加密机制。通过使用AWS IAM(Identity and Access Management),可以设置细粒度的权限控制,确保只有授权的用户可以访问敏感数据。
对于图片轮播等功能,AWS还支持HTTPS协议,确保数据在传输过程中的安全性。借助这些安全机制,开发者可以在不担心数据泄露的情况下,安心托管和展示资源。
总结:利用AWS优化网站体验
结合AWS强大的云服务,开发者不仅能够实现图片自动轮播的效果,还能利用AWS的弹性扩展、安全保障和全球加速等功能,提升网站的性能和用户体验。从图片存储到数据分发,AWS为开发者提供了丰富的工具和服务,让开发者专注于创意和用户体验的优化,而无需担心基础设施的维护。
总的来说,AWS不仅仅是一个强大的云平台,它还为开发者提供了高效、灵活且安全的解决方案,让每一个网站都能在全球范围内提供流畅、高效的用户体验。
这篇文章介绍了如何结合AWS云服务实现HTML图片自动轮播,并详细讲解了AWS的优势和应用,最后总结了如何利用AWS的强大功能提升网站性能。

评论列表 (0条):
加载更多评论 Loading...